Box Score Moorhead, MN – Despite a career-high 21 points from
Jalen Jaspers and freshman
Kevin Jensen just missing a double double, the University of Mary couldn't contain a high-powered Minnesota State University Moorhead squad. The Dragons burned past the Marauders 92-77 in the final regular season weekend of Northern Sun play.
Jaspers drove hard to the basket all night and hit 9-of-14 shots on his way to 21 points. The junior guard also led the Marauders with six assists. His previous career best total was 19 points, which he accomplished twice.
A fixture in the starting lineup since the season-ending injury to
Alex Dorr, Jensen scored 12 points and hauled down a team-high nine rebounds. He scored his points on four three-point shots, all coming in the first half.
Josh Turner reached double figures for the seventh straight game, scoring 18 points. The NSIC leader in three pointers made per game hit four treys in the game to exceed his average. The U-Mary senior guard also had five rebounds and three assists.
Mark Musungayi added eight points and eight rebounds.
Brandon Tyler came off the bench to score eight points.
The two teams combined to shoot 58 treys, making 25. The Marauders (4-21, overall, 3-18 NSIC) finished 12-of-35 behind the arc and the Dragons (17-10, 11-10) connected on 13-of-23.
The big difference in the game between the two teams came at the free throw line. MSUM finished 19-of-22 while U-Mary was 5-of-8.
The Dragons, who snapped a three-game losing streak, led by as many as nine points in the first half before the Marauders whittled the deficit to two on a Jaspers layup. A three-ball late in the session by Tyler Vaughn let the Dragons enter intermission up 39-34.
Down 11 in the second half, Tyler scored the first eight Marauders points in a 10-2 run to pull U-Mary within 54-51. The freshman guard hit a three pointer, made two of three free throws after he was fouled on a shot beyond the arc and converted a three point play.
The Dragons immediately regained control using a 13-2 run keyed by two treys and a jumper from Anthony Tucker. MSUM maintained a double digit lead much of the rest of the night with U-Mary getting no closer than eight points.
A two-time NSIC player of the week, Tucker scored 23 points, dished ten assists and hauled down eight rebounds Vaughn had 21 points and Alex Novak posted 16 points, 12 rebounds and three blocks.
